It is hard to credit that this is the same event we attended two years ago. That was the first “Simply Porsche” run by Beaulieu as part of their “Simply” series of marque-specific events. There were perhaps 100 cars scattered around the grounds, it was pleasant. Sean had a moment of inspiration and a quiet word in Beaulieu’s ear, “let us help you out with this”, and now look at it; one of the biggest Porsche gatherings in the country with the Beaulieu grounds full of more than 600 Porsches.
The attendance was all the more remarkable once you consider the “competition” the event had on Sunday, Wilton Supercar Show, Bromley Pageant, Goodwood breakfast club, etc.
This event is now a triumph for both the club and Beaulieu. It is, without doubt, the most family friendly of the Porsche events with something for everyone. Long may it continue. Thanks to everyone involved in organising it. What is the date for next year?
